JEM Logistics is built on the principles of independence and hands-on service, established by our founder, Daniel Jemmett. Daniel’s journey in transport began nearly 25 years ago, starting small with just two wagons around the year 2000.
The pivotal moment came in 2016 when Daniel took a decisive leap of faith, establishing JEM Logistics after recognising the need for a distinct direction — one focused on reliability, compliance and a customer-first ethos.
Building the new company required conviction, and several key team members immediately joined his vision. Many of those original colleagues remain the backbone of JEM Logistics today. Under Daniel’s leadership the company has grown from a handful of trucks to 47+ vehicles, with in-house MOT and maintenance services ensuring every vehicle meets the highest standards.
John Gray’s career journey is a testament to hands-on experience and dedication. Leaving school at 16 with no formal qualifications, John immediately began working in removals until he was old enough to drive — and never looked back.
His path progressed from driving vans and trucks to recovery work, cementing a lifelong career in transport. For eight years he played a pivotal role in helping another local haulier build their business before they ceased trading.
John initially joined JEM Logistics with the simple intention of driving. His skills and commitment quickly convinced Daniel to bring him into a leadership role. Starting from a fleet of just six trucks, John has been instrumental in scaling operations to their current size and is the operational heartbeat of the company today.
